DevOps и SRE — это два приложения для улучшения программного обеспечения, которые помогают улучшить работу других подобных программ и приложений. Они оба играют важную роль в оказании помощи сайтам и приложениям в случаях ошибок и проблем с загрузкой страниц.
У них есть работники и правоохранительные органы, которые готовы решить такие проблемы с сетью и веб-сайтами.
Основные выводы
- DevOps — это методология разработки программного обеспечения, в которой особое внимание уделяется сотрудничеству между командами разработки и эксплуатации. В то же время SRE (Site Reliability Engineering) — это подход к ИТ-операциям, направленный на обеспечение надежности и стабильности программных систем.
- DevOps направлен на повышение скорости и гибкости разработки программного обеспечения, а SRE — на минимизацию времени простоя и системных сбоев.
- DevOps больше фокусируется на разработке программного обеспечения, а SRE — на ИТ-операциях.
DevOps против SRE
DevOps — это методология, использующая набор методов и инструментов для управления процессами разработки программного обеспечения, включающая сотрудничество между разработчиками программного обеспечения и операционными группами. SRE — это набор принципов и методов, направленных на проектирование и внедрение высокоустойчивых, масштабируемых и надежных систем.
DevOps — это комбинированное слово для двух разных слов: разработка и эксплуатация. Это программное обеспечение в основном используется для разработки продуктов, когда это требуется любому пользователю или даже всему трафику, который блокирует веб-сайт.
Они также помогают удалять функции, которые публикуются приложениями, когда их запрашивает владелец.
SRE — это программное обеспечение для модификации программ, которое помогает устранять проблемы, с которыми сталкиваются пользователи, когда они пытаются войти в систему или зарегистрироваться в своих учетных записях на разных сайтах.
Их основной успех связан с их стратегическими идеями, которые помогают сочетать функции программного обеспечения с операционными устройствами информационных технологий. Они готовы устранить проблемы, с которыми сталкиваются пользователи на любом устройстве или веб-сайте.
Сравнительная таблица
Параметры сравнения | DevOps | SRE |
---|---|---|
Основная цель | Шаблон для ссылки | Дает практические советы |
Цель | Развивающийся | Надежность на сайтах |
Команда состоит из | Инженеры, специалисты и т. | Инженеры сайта в основном |
Год разработки | 2009 | 2003 |
Учредитель | Патрик Дебуа | Бен Треймор |
Что такое DevOps?
DevOps означает разработку и эксплуатацию, так как это в основном то, что они делают с каждой проблемой, с которой они сталкиваются и которую задают клиенты.
Они помогают медленно ломать алгоритмическое программное обеспечение, которое сталкивается с проблемами с трафиком и ошибками веб-сайта.
После разрушения системы DevOps обеспечивает правильное решение, которое решает большинство проблем, с которыми сталкиваются клиенты, а затем работает над выпуском продукта для общественности.
Этот тип выпуска происходит гладко, но быстро, чтобы не заставлять клиентов и владельцев веб-сайтов ждать своих продуктов.
Конечному продукту всегда можно доверять, поскольку он будет гарантированно безопасным, а также защищенной формой предыдущей системы с прослушиванием.
DevOps — это прикладное программное обеспечение, известное как формат, который присутствует между двумя другими аналогичными программами, предоставляющими функции, аналогичные DevOps.
Два других программного обеспечения — это ESM или Enterprise Systems Management и Agile Development, оба из которых выполняют функции, объединенные DevOps.
Они гарантируют, что скорость любого веб-сайта, подвергшегося технической атаке, вернется к своему обычному темпу, который мог быть нарушен из-за вредоносного ПО.
DevOps умеет отслеживать изменения, которые могут происходить на любом заблокированном веб-сайте или веб-странице.
Они отменяют эффекты и изменения, которые, возможно, никогда не планировались владельцем сайта, и создают новые алгоритмы и конфигурации для того же сайта.
Эти новые алгоритмы будут построены таким образом, что их будет трудно взломать или атаковать каким-либо другим программным обеспечением.
Они помогают упростить выполнение функций, выполняемых веб-сайтом, чтобы пользователи не чувствовали себя неудовлетворенными услугами, которые они получают.
У них есть высокоэффективный персонал, который находит быстрые решения проблем, а также достаточно изобретателен, чтобы найти лучшие методы для устранения сомнений.
Что такое СРЭ?
SRE расшифровывается как Site Reliability Engineering. Само это название объясняет, что делает программное обеспечение, и цель его присутствия в области информационных технологий.
У них есть разные решения проблем, с которыми сталкиваются пользователи в сети, и они предлагают пользователям инновационные подходы к решениям.
Они очень хорошо умеют смешивать два совершенно разных аспекта ИТ-сферы. То есть они сочетают в себе различные функции, присутствующие в устройстве, с различными ИТ-системами и операциями.
Он был создан для подготовки технического алгоритма, отвечающего требованиям, предъявляемым различными пользователями системы.
Они гарантируют, что каждая проблема, поднятая пользователями в отношении проблем, с которыми они сталкиваются на платформе, рассматривается с максимальной осторожностью и точностью.
Алгоритмы урезаны до предельно низкого уровня, на котором стало бы легче читать изменения, произошедшие с исходным форматом.
Он обеспечивает наземную поддержку пользователям, которым требуется помощь при обнаружении ошибки в системе или при угрозе атаки вредоносного ПО.
SRE также помогает разрушить существующую систему управления веб-сайтом и найти новый набор менеджеров.
Когда веб-сайт предоставляется им для очистки и возврата, SRE также добавляет дополнительные обновления, а также обновленные версии существующих функций.
Основные различия между DevOps и SRE
- В то время как SRE является более старой версией программного обеспечения для модификации приложений и была представлена в 2003 году, тогда как DevOps, с другой стороны, немного новее и была представлена в 2009 году.
- Техническая команда DevOps состоит из многих профессионалов. В их число входят ИТ-инженеры, разработчики и эксперты в самых разных областях. Но спасательная команда в аварийной ситуации SRE в основном состоит из одних инженеров.
- В то время как DevOps предоставляет пользователям готовый шаблон для решения любых проблем, с которыми они сталкиваются во время серфинга, SRE, с другой стороны, более известен тем, что дает клиентам советы о том, как решить проблему.
- Весь девиз DevOps вращался вокруг процесса разработки любого программного обеспечения, тогда как девиз SRE был исключительно на надежности компании со стороны пользователей, которые предоставляют свои веб-сайты для устранения неполадок.
- Процессы взлома алгоритмов зараженного ПО как в DevOps, так и в SRE различаются. В то время как SRE добавляет обновленные функции к тому же веб-сайту, DevOps не умирает.